Giuliana Benetton: Fashion, Fame & The Billionaire Family Legacy

Giuliana Benetton built one of the most recognizable global fashion brands through bold color choices and tightly integrated family leadership. Her approach combined Italian design sensibility with scalable production, turning a small wool shop into a multinational enterprise.

From cooperative roots to high-profile licensing deals, Giuliana helped Benetton navigate changing retail landscapes while maintaining a distinctive visual identity. Her influence extends beyond style into business structure and brand storytelling.

Aspect Detail Impact
Brand Origin Founded in 1965 in Ponzano Veneto, Italy Established a colorful, youth-focused identity
Family Role Giuliana as co-founder and strategist Aligned creative vision with long-term governance
Design Signature Bright patterns and coordinated sportswear Differentiated the label in crowded markets
Global Reach Licensed partnerships and direct stores worldwide Accelerated international revenue growth
